Transaction 635372f2aa633b1cbc4f15863d10d08dd2534d7f286e6ddbb5d0885fa75737c4
1 Input
1 Outputs
- 635372f2aa633b1cbc4f15863d10d08dd2534d7f286e6ddbb5d0885fa75737c4:0
value 3048974
address 1HQthD7TMNpemFJrRqRaWCATSHVAFA46FS